📋 Group Discussion (GD) Analysis Guide: Can Digital Health Tools Improve the Management of Chronic Diseases?

🌐 Introduction to the Topic

📖 Opening Context

Chronic diseases such as diabetes, hypertension, and cardiovascular conditions affect millions globally, straining healthcare systems. With the rise of digital health tools, there is potential for revolutionizing chronic disease management.

📜 Background

Digital health encompasses tools like mobile apps, wearable devices, and telehealth platforms that enable personalized healthcare solutions. Their integration into chronic disease management aims to enhance monitoring, compliance, and outcomes.

📊 Quick Facts and Key Statistics

  • 🌍 Global Chronic Disease Burden: Over 60% of deaths worldwide are due to chronic diseases (WHO, 2023).
  • 📈 Digital Health Market: Expected to reach $660 billion by 2025, driven by telehealth and wearable technology (Grand View Research, 2023).
  • 📱 User Engagement: 50% of patients using mobile health apps report better medication adherence.
  • 💻 Remote Monitoring Impact: Reduces hospital readmissions by 38% (Journal of Telemedicine and e-Health, 2024).
  • 🌐 Global Access: 72% of healthcare providers now offer at least one digital service.

👥 Stakeholders and Their Roles

  • Patients: Use tools for self-monitoring and lifestyle management.
  • Healthcare Providers: Analyze data to offer personalized treatments.
  • Tech Companies: Innovate and deploy solutions like apps, wearables, and AI platforms.
  • Governments: Formulate regulations and incentivize adoption.
  • Insurers: Integrate tools to reduce costs and improve patient outcomes.

🎯 Achievements and Challenges

✅ Achievements

  • Enhanced Monitoring: Tools like continuous glucose monitors provide real-time data for diabetes management.
  • Improved Access: Telehealth bridges gaps for patients in remote areas.
  • Cost-Effectiveness: Reduced emergency visits and hospital stays through preventive care.
  • Engagement Boost: Apps promoting lifestyle changes lead to improved long-term health outcomes.

🚧 Challenges

  • Digital Divide: Limited access in low-income areas hinders adoption.
  • Data Privacy Concerns: Risks of breaches and misuse of sensitive health information.
  • Interoperability Issues: Difficulty in integrating multiple platforms into existing healthcare systems.

🌍 Global Comparisons

  • 🇺🇸 USA: High adoption rates due to robust infrastructure.
  • 🇮🇳 India: Emerging market with innovative low-cost solutions but facing rural connectivity issues.

📋 Case Study

Diabetes Management in Sweden: A nationwide adoption of digital tools reduced diabetes complications by 25%.

📋 Strategic Analysis of Strengths and Weaknesses

SWOT Analysis

  • Strengths: Real-time monitoring, cost reductions in healthcare delivery.
  • ⚠️ Weaknesses: Dependence on stable internet, high initial costs for devices.
  • 🚀 Opportunities: Integration of AI for predictive analytics, expansion in developing countries.
  • Threats: Regulatory hurdles, risk of technology fatigue among users.
